In 30 seconds
Problem: Telcos face a fundamental shift as ACMA scraps industry self-regulation for a mandatory, directly enforceable standard, driven by high-pressure sales tactics and consumers sold plans they cannot afford.
The Shift: Penalties now reach $10 million or 30 per cent of turnover, with registration and deregistration powers attached. Responsible selling moves from aspiration to legal requirement.
The Solution: Organisations that already practise human-centred, ethical selling gain a structural head start. Responsible selling was always right. Now it is required, and the gap between the two has just become very expensive to ignore.
